Images shown are for reference only. Parts should be matched by part number. Contact us to help find your part.

HY0233397A

Price: $0.00


PUMP - FUEL

Details

Also listed as HY0233397A HY233397A HYSTER0233397A HY233397A 0233397A 233397A

Customer reviews

HY0233396

HY145916

HY0233473

MI2-016N674-70
$0.71